[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[IDV #MEM-850560]: Plotting map background (from a shape file) on topography



Dave,

If I understand correctly from the list, this issue is resolved so we are
closing it for now.

Best,

Unidata IDV Support

> Full Name: Dave Dempsey
> Email Address: address@hidden
> Organization: San Francisco State University
> Package Version: 5.0u2 build date:2014-10-02 07:05 UTC
> Operating System: Mac OS X
> Hardware: Java: home: /Applications/IDV_5.0u2/jre.bundle/Contents/Home/jre 
> version: 1.7.0_67 j3d:1.6.0-pre9-daily-experimental daily
> Description of problem: Error message is:
> Creating display: Topography
> Sampling set is not compatible with domain
> Sampling set is not compatible with domain
> 
> Did the following:
> 
> (1) Loaded a 500 m resolution shape file of US county boundaries (a local 
> file) and selected a non-default region to display. (No problem with this.)
> (2) Loaded a recent CONDUIT 12 km NAM model output file (via a Unidata 
> catalog), selected the analysis time (rather than the default of multiple 
> times), and specified the region as "Match display".
> (3) In the Dashboard, selected Field Selector > Data Sources: > Formulas > 
> Maps > 3D Map > Topography, and clicked the "Create Display" button.
> 
> The results were the error messages above. (I would attach the shape file 
> that I used, but it's 14MB and that's pretty big to attach to an email 
> message. Shouldn't matter what it is, though, right?)
> 
> ******************
> Stack trace:
> visad.VisADException: Sampling set is not compatible with domain
> at visad.FlatField.resample(FlatField.java:4591)
> at ucar.unidata.data.grid.GridUtil.resampleGridInner(GridUtil.java:4419)
> at ucar.unidata.data.grid.GridUtil.resampleGrid(GridUtil.java:4311)
> at ucar.unidata.data.grid.GridUtil.slice(GridUtil.java:2685)
> at ucar.unidata.data.grid.GridUtil.slice(GridUtil.java:2663)
> at ucar.unidata.data.grid.GridUtil.slice(GridUtil.java:2642)
> at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
> at 
> s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57)
> at 
> s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
> at java.lang.reflect.Method.invoke(Method.java:606)
> at org.python.core.PyReflectedFunction.__call__(PyReflectedFunction.java:186)
> at org.python.core.PyReflectedFunction.__call__(PyReflectedFunction.java:204)
> at org.python.core.PyObject.__call__(PyObject.java:404)
> at org.python.core.PyObject.__call__(PyObject.java:408)
> at org.python.pycode._pyx90.make3DMap$1(<string>:17)
> at org.python.pycode._pyx90.call_function(<string>)
> at org.python.core.PyTableCode.call(PyTableCode.java:165)
> at org.python.core.PyBaseCode.call(PyBaseCode.java:149)
> at org.python.core.PyFunction.__call__(PyFunction.java:327)
> at org.python.pycode._pyx102.f$0(<string>:1)
> at org.python.pycode._pyx102.call_function(<string>)
> at org.python.core.PyTableCode.call(PyTableCode.java:165)
> at org.python.core.PyCode.call(PyCode.java:18)
> at org.python.core.Py.runCode(Py.java:1261)
> at org.python.core.__builtin__.eval(__builtin__.java:484)
> at org.python.core.__builtin__.eval(__builtin__.java:488)
> at org.python.util.PythonInterpreter.eval(PythonInterpreter.java:190)
> at ucar.unidata.data.DerivedDataChoice.getData(DerivedDataChoice.java:795)
> at ucar.unidata.data.DataChoice.getData(DataChoice.java:637)
> at ucar.unidata.data.DataInstance.getData(DataInstance.java:243)
> at ucar.unidata.data.DataInstance.getData(DataInstance.java:207)
> at ucar.unidata.data.grid.GridDataInstance.init(GridDataInstance.java:206)
> at ucar.unidata.data.grid.GridDataInstance.<init>(GridDataInstance.java:163)
> at ucar.unidata.data.grid.GridDataInstance.<init>(GridDataInstance.java:144)
> at 
> ucar.unidata.idv.control.GridDisplayControl.doMakeDataInstance(GridDisplayControl.java:299)
> at 
> ucar.unidata.idv.control.DisplayControlImpl.initializeDataInstance(DisplayControlImpl.java:3278)
> at 
> ucar.unidata.idv.control.DisplayControlImpl.setData(DisplayControlImpl.java:3234)
> at ucar.unidata.idv.control.PlanViewControl.setData(PlanViewControl.java:664)
> at ucar.unidata.idv.control.PlanViewControl.init(PlanViewControl.java:489)
> at 
> ucar.unidata.idv.control.DisplayControlImpl.init(DisplayControlImpl.java:1402)
> at 
> ucar.unidata.idv.control.DisplayControlImpl.init(DisplayControlImpl.java:1085)
> at ucar.unidata.idv.ControlDescriptor.initControl(ControlDescriptor.java:986)
> at ucar.unidata.idv.ControlDescriptor$1.run(ControlDescriptor.java:911)
> at ucar.unidata.util.Misc$3.run(Misc.java:1243)
> 
> 
> 


Ticket Details
===================
Ticket ID: MEM-850560
Department: Support IDV
Priority: Normal
Status: Closed